HMC’s Alex Parslow, Sr. Vice President Pre-K-12 Education, will be presenting at the 2014 California School Boards Association (CSBA) Annual Education Conference on December 15, 2014. In her presentation, Improving Academics with Funding and Facilities, she will discuss how to successfully fund facilities that support student achievement, community outreach and a healthy environment. Attendees will also learn how local and state programs can replace portable classrooms, modernize outdated and inefficient facilities, construct needed buildings and revitalize the community for ongoing support.
